Children are taxed just like adults, and just like adults that means that if they've no income they can earn up to £18,570 a year from savings without paying tax on it (that's the £12,570 personal allowance + £5,000 starting savings allowance + the £1,000 personal savings allowance (PSA)).

Under-18s do not have … greenwich trust limited graduate trainee 2019WebApr 6, 2024 · The rate of Income Tax you pay depends on how much of your taxable income is above your Personal Allowance in the tax year. Your Personal Allowance is the amount of income you do not pay tax on. The current tax year is from 6 April 2024 to 5 April 2024 and most people's Personal Allowance is £12,570.
